In the midst of ongoing organizing efforts by Apple workers in New
York City and several other locations throughout the country that have
been met with intense anti-union pushback from the company, Apple has
come under fire for violations to its official human rights
policy. Federal regulators and employees are speaking out about
Apple’s repeated violation of workers rights - especially when it
comes to worker organizing. Investors in Apple have voiced concerns
about these violations, and begun taking action.
“There’s a big apparent gap between Apple’s stated human rights
policies regarding worker organizing, and its practices,” said NYC Comptroller and CWA ally Brad Lander.
